EVANDER – A successful clean-up operation lead to the arrest of three illegal miners (zama-zama) in a field next to the Mpumalanga Guest House at the Winkelhaak Mine on Thursday, 21 January.
Water pumps and materials used for illegal mining were confiscated and taken to the police station.
The operation which was lead by the Evander Police Station Commander, Lieut-Col Jenny Albert, saw the police and their K9 unit team up with the companies Pan Africa, MavCorp, Jelani Security and SSG to ensure a successful operation.
The illegal miners appeared in court on Monday, 25 January.
